Giovanni Battista Tiepolo
1696-1770
Nobility, Liberality, and a Third Virtue
10 1/8 x 12 5/16 inches (258 x 313 mm)
Pen and brown-black ink, gray wash, over black chalk, on paper.
IV, 112
Purchased by Pierpont Morgan (1837-1913) in 1909.
Notes
One of a series of 108 drawings by Giambattista Tiepolo from an album bearing the title, "TIEPOLO DESSINS ORIGINAUX", inscribed by Edward Cheney, "E.C. Venice 1852 May 31 / bought from the Conte Corniani Algarotti".
